Glassdoor users rated their interview experience at Token.io as 70% positive with a difficulty rating score of 2.78 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ty). Candidates interviewing for Frontend Developer and Android Engineer rated their interviews as the hardest, whereas interviews for Software Engineer and Software Developer roles were rated as the easiest.
The hiring process at Token.io takes an average of 19 days when considering 10 user submitted interviews across all job titles. To compare, the average duration of hiring at similar companies like BlackRock, Inc. is 14 days, Fabricated Software, Inc. is 2 days, and Apple Inc. is 21 days. Candidates applying for Frontend Developer had the quickest hiring process (on average 14 days), whereas Software Engineer roles had the slowest hiring process (on average 21 days).

I applied through a recruiter. The process took 2 weeks. I interviewed at Token.io (Berlin) in Dec 2022
Interview
Fast paced, challenging enough.
3 round of interviews. Behavioural, technical and architectural.
Behavioural one to measure if you can adapt working with different timezones and multi cultural teams.
Technical is entirely with javascript, css and react. Very clear on the expectations of the role and instructions of the interview questions.
Infrastructural is to see how solution oriented you are in terms of development and what's your know how level on security measures of a web application.
